Marshweed is a group of musicians who plays the music of Los Angeles-based performer-composer Heather Lockie. Drawing from whatever soundmaking devices are at hand - a string trio, close vocal harmonies, a penny whistle, a live-processed field recording, an oven rack, a folk song, a bell - Marshweed weaves sonic tapestries ranging from aggro-noise sound painting to folk Americana ballad to doomy chanting, back to ballad, onward to atonal pop-culture-referencing chant, sometimes ending at the beach.
